that mesotherapy, when associated with other therapeutic techniques, for instance TENS (Transcutaneous Electric Nerve Stimulation), has faster good results in reducing pain than when they are applied in isolation, which is similar to the results dem- onstrated in other papers, where mesotherapy was associated with other therapeutic techniques, such as TENS and laser or dynamic thera- pies. 14.15 On the beginning of this decade, on a meeting where several medi- cal specialties were present, it was reviewed and validated the rational use, indications, advantages and contraindications of mesotherapy with the purpose to create a series of recommendations of the appro- priate use of Intradermal therapy. It was concluded that intradermal administration is effective to fight pain and it should be considered another therapeutic “weapon” that doctors can use. 16 In the case of the persistence of pain implies a new clinical evaluation and therapeutic decision. 3 Currently, in France, mesotherapy is recognized by the French Medical Academy as a legitimate technique to control pain, its costs are reim- bursed by Social security and it is applied in most sports and in medi- cal centers as well. 17 References 1.
